Tel Aviv Port

The architecture is beautiful, but I suggest wandering around without a strict plan. Some of the best views and photo ops are hidden away from the main paths.

I think hanging out at the beach next to the port is a must! It's a great place to relax but remember to bring sunscreen—it's easy to get burned!

Definitely check out the food stalls at the port, but my advice is to go early around 11 AM to beat the lunchtime crowd. You’ll find better spots to eat and it’s more chill.

Port of Jaffa

Grab a snack or drink from one of the local kiosks instead of dining in a restaurant. You’ll save some cash and still get to enjoy the vibe of the port.

Try to visit during the late afternoon when the sun starts setting. The views over the Mediterranean are truly breathtaking, and perfect for those Instagram shots! Plus, it's cooler and less crowded.
